Key Skills to Look For
Crisis Communications
A communications specialist in UAE Dubai should be adept at handling crisis communications, including developing response strategies and managing media relations during challenging times.
Social Media Management
Proficiency in social media management is crucial, including creating content, managing campaigns, and analyzing engagement metrics.
Content Creation
The ability to create compelling content across various formats, such as press releases, blog posts, and social media posts, is essential for a communications specialist.
Media Relations
Building and maintaining strong media relations is vital for securing coverage and managing the company's public image.
Internal Communications
A communications specialist should be skilled in developing internal communications strategies to keep employees informed and engaged.
Brand Storytelling
The ability to craft and tell the company's brand story in a compelling way is a key skill for a communications specialist.
Digital Marketing Tools
Familiarity with digital marketing tools, such as analytics software and social media scheduling tools, is important for measuring the effectiveness of communications efforts.
Project Management
A communications specialist should be able to manage multiple projects simultaneously, prioritizing tasks and meeting deadlines.
Screening & Interviewing Process
Reviewing Portfolios
Begin by reviewing the candidate's portfolio to assess their experience and the quality of their work.
Assessing Skills
Use skills assessments or practical tests to evaluate the candidate's proficiency in areas like writing, social media management, and crisis communications.
Conducting Interviews
Conduct thorough interviews to assess the candidate's experience, skills, and fit for the role and company culture.
Sample Interview Questions for Communications Specialist
- Can you describe a time when you had to handle a crisis communications situation?
- How do you stay up-to-date with the latest trends in communications?
- What strategies do you use to engage employees through internal communications?
- How do you measure the success of a communications campaign?
- Can you give an example of a successful media relations campaign you've managed?
- How do you handle conflicting priorities and tight deadlines?
Factors for Successful Collaboration
Clear Briefs
Providing clear briefs to the communications specialist ensures they understand the project's objectives and requirements.
Regular Check-ins
Regular check-ins help ensure the project is on track and allow for any necessary adjustments.
Project Management Tools
Using project management tools like Trello or Asana can help streamline the workflow and improve collaboration.
Contracts and Agreements
Having a clear contract or agreement in place protects both parties and ensures a smooth working relationship.
Confidentiality
Ensuring confidentiality agreements are in place is crucial for protecting sensitive information.
Challenges to Watch Out For
Cultural Differences
Cultural differences can sometimes pose challenges in communications. Being aware of these differences can help mitigate potential issues.
Language Barriers
Language barriers can also impact communications. Ensuring the communications specialist is proficient in the necessary languages can help.
Keeping Up with Trends
The communications landscape is constantly evolving. Ensuring the specialist stays up-to-date with the latest trends is crucial.
